Robotic Hoovers

Ideally, robot vacuums should complement your hand-driven vacuum cleaner and be used for regular or weekly cleaning. Many owners report that their floors appear and feel better after regular use.

Think about mapping capabilities that enable your robot to navigate more efficiently and keep track of where you live. Other features include spot/zone cleaning recharge and resume, as well as advanced navigation and object recognition.

They're convenient

Robotic vacuums are an excellent option for many homes. They are safe, easy to use and are able to be operated by people of all tech levels. They can be programmed to clean the home according to the schedule that is suitable for your family. The latest models can also tackle obstacles like furniture and pet toys. Some models come with sensors that detect dirt, dust or other debris and adjust the cleaning mode to suit. This will save you time and effort since you can utilize the same robot to vacuum, mop, or both.

In contrast to traditional vacuum cleaners robotic hoovers are powered by batteries and can be moved around your home without getting caught in cords or tangled under furniture. They can be programmed to clean certain areas of your home, and even tackle stairs. Many of these robots also recognize cluttered surfaces and then automatically return to their docking station to recharge their batteries if it is low. They can even pause their work and pick up where they were when they left. This makes them perfect for busy homes with pets and children.

Most robotic hoovers have built-in sensors that detect and avoid obstacles, and detect tiles, rugs, flooring, and hardwood. They also come with an integrated camera that allows them to see around corners and in tight spaces. Additionally, some robots have virtual barriers that allow you to create "no-go" zones to prevent vacuums from entering certain areas of your home.

Certain robot vacuums, including the iRobot Roomba can be capable of taking photos of walls and objects within your home and sharing them with iRobot's Scale AI gig workers to improve their recognition technology. While this feature is beneficial but it is not suitable for families with privacy concerns. Before you purchase a robot vacuum, it is important to ensure that your data will be secure.

Like all machines, robotic cleaners need some attention to ensure they function properly. Regular cleaning of brushes, filters and sensors can help optimize performance and prevent clogs. To stop the bin from overflowing onto your robot, you should empty it often. You can also clean and dry the pads (if they can be reused) between use. In addition, the battery needs to be recharged periodically and you may have to replace it on a more frequent basis if you utilize your robot for sweeping and mopping frequently.

irobot-roomba-i4-evo-wi-fi-connected-robot-vacuum-clean-by-room-with-smart-mapping-compatible-with-alexa-ideal-for-pet-hair-carpet-and-hard-floors-1365-small.jpgThe first robot vacuum cleaner was the Electrolux Trilobite which utilized sensors to help navigate and clean floors. It was the predecessor to modern robotic vacuums. It didn't catch on, but it inspired inventors to create the modern technology we have today.
